The postcode NG34 0JB is located in North Kesteven, in the county of Lincolnsh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NG34 0JB is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
NG34 0JB is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NG34 0JB as Rural residents > Farming communities > Agricultural communities.
The closest road name to NG34 0JB is Holland Road which is centered 1.03 km away.
The closest primary school to NG34 0JB (for ages 11 and under) is Brown's Church of England Primary School, Horbling.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on April 30,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Kesteven and Sleaford High School Selective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on November 14,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of NG34 0JB is The Plough Inn and is 1.63 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on February 12, 2022. The nearest takeaway food is available from Billingborough Fish Bar and is 2.5 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on December 8, 2020.
33.3%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ps. 66.7% of residents have broadband access of 0-2 Mbps.
Policing for NG34 0JB is covered by the Lincolnshire police force association and Lincolnshire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
